Lead Expedition Instructor: Functions as the team leader for assigned expeditions; Responsible for the overall safety and risk management of all participants; Supervises and leads groups of up to ten students during the 20-Day, 8-Day or 5-Day Expedition; Provides skills instruction in backpacking, wilderness camping, map and compass, flat water and white water canoeing, rock climbing and rappelling, first aid, nutrition, personal hygiene and ecology; Provides small group and individual counseling for adolescents of varying backgrounds; Facilitates interpersonal skill development for students; Supervises all course activities; Conducts Orientation programs for students, families, and referring agencies; Attends summer staff training as required; Completes all course reporting in a timely manner; Leads 1-Day courses for groups as available; Performs related duties as required. Expedition Instructor: Responsible for the safety and risk management of all Expedition program participants; Supervises and leads groups of up to ten students during the 20-Day, 8-Day or 4-Day Expedition; Provides skills instruction in backpacking, wilderness camping, map and compass, flat water and white water canoeing, rock climbing and rappelling, first aid, nutrition, personal hygiene and ecology; Provides small group and individual counseling for adolescents of varying backgrounds; Facilitates interpersonal skill development for students; Supervises all course activities; Conducts Orientation programs for students, families, and referring agencies; Attends summer staff training as required; Completes all course reporting in a timely manner; Leads 1-Day courses for groups as available; Performs related duties as required.
